The Slot Fan’s Guide to Olden Day One Arm Bandits

A quick search on eBay reveals some interesting results for antique slot machines. Few people would believe that archaic devices with minimal spinning reels and a handful of symbols could be worth a small fortune. Collectors know better. Slot machines from the 1930s and 1940s can fetch a pretty penny, depending on their condition, brand name, and rarity. For example, an Antique 1930s Mills War Eagle 5 cent Nickel Slot Machine can fetch as much as $2,595 on the market. These contraptions are typically a little worse for wear, and they may not have all their original working parts. In the United States, there are rules in place which regulate the sale of antique slot machines, and certain states may not qualify.

If you’re looking to spend a small fortune, you may be on the prowl for an antique 1899 Mills 5c Dewey slot machine. This device retails for $16,800, and it is in its mint, original condition. These devices were expertly crafted, full of intricately detailed artwork and mechanical parts. If the sticker price is a little steep, you may wish to consider the Mills Novelty Company Owl Slot Machine antique at a price of $15,750. These slot games are worlds apart from the video slots we see nowadays at land-based casinos and online casinos. These are fully functional freestanding machines with ball and claw feet, solid oak carved frames, and beautifully-furnished metal housing. It’s always important to check for damage, especially with the wood items.

Specs of Antique Slot Machines

The Antique range of slot machines are extremely expensive, and can retail at $19,000+ apiece. The original machines were created around 1906, and have a devout following among slot machine collectors and gaming experts. Many slot fans choose to refurbish their antique slot machines, to keep them in pristine condition. The antique slot machines business is a roaring trade, with a niche market of highly motivated buyers and sellers. Only the most skilled technical experts in slot machine restoration professionals can work in this arena, since customers are highly specific and detail oriented when it comes to these high-priced antiques. The typical weight of an antique slot machine ranges from 75 pounds through 100 pounds. Their dimensions are typically 16” x 16” x 28” in height.

There are many examples of popular antique slots, including the following:

  • 1941 Mills Diamond Front
  • Mills Hi-Top
  • Mills Bursting Cherry
  • 1938 Mills Roman Head 5 Cent
  • 1946 Jennings Super Deluxe Club Chief
  • 1935 Watling Coin Front 25 Cent
  • 1947 Mills Black Cherry 5 Cent
  • 1933 Watling Treasury 5 Cent
  • 1948 Mills Blue Bell 10 Cent
  • 1950 Pace Four Reel Harrah’s Club 10 Cent

The price of an antique slot machine may range from a few dollars to as much as $50,000 +, depending on its condition, rarity and how much the buyer is willing to pay for it. Many antique collectors seek these devices as decorative pieces, or as investments for posterity. The most common brand is Mills, both with its Golden Nugget slot machine and its Orange Front QT slot machine variants.

Slot Game Variety Over the Years

Believe it or not, various slots enthusiasts consider any slot machine created after 1930 as a contemporary slot machine, and not an antique. These contemporary machines are largely comprised of replacement parts, and many of them have been fully restored and tested. The cost of these machines is less than those with a limited number of replacement parts. If you’re looking to buy an antique slot machine, it is best to select a machine that is relatively untouched, and in its original mint condition. Once restoration work has begun, the perceived value of the machine diminishes. If you find an e-commerce platform selling a 1930s/40s slot machine under $3,000, it is likely a contemporary machine with replacement parts.

The strict definition of an antique is a collectible object that has a high value because of its considerable age. In the United States, the Customs Service regards antiques as items that are at least 100 years old. With slot machine games, antiques are considered old-school slot games – typically the 3-reel classic slots. Nowadays, players can enjoy sophisticated HD slots with 5 spinning reels and hundreds of paylines. Video animation, 3D technology, and a virtual presence are worlds apart from the physical nature of antique slot machine games. The Making of a YouTube Superstar

NG Slot uploaded his first video on Feb 19, 2017. The video was called Buffalo Grand Slot Machine Live Play Max Bet. In it, the future YouTube sensation tried his luck on the Buffalo Grand slot machine.

It’s easy to see that this was a first attempt. It’s a simple camera recording of a slot machine gaming session, without any of NG’s signature traits. He only plays on one machine. He doesn’t show us around the casino he’s in. And he doesn’t wow us with his energetic personality. In fact, he doesn’t even show his face:

But we all have to start somewhere. The fact that his very first attempt didn’t turn out perfect didn’t discourage him. NG continued to upload consistently. With time, he learned all of the tricks of the vlogging trade and developed his own, unique style. Now, just a few short years later, his videos have been watched over 133 million times and he was awarded YouTube Silver Play Button for surpassing 100,000 subscribers.

I am proud of getting my YouTube Silver Play Button. Thank you to YouTube for giving us an opportunity to be a creator. @ytcreators@TeamYouTubepic.twitter.com/VEralMjBkv

— NG Slot (@NGslot) February 13, 2020

And it doesn’t look like the growth of his channel will stop anytime soon. On an average month, NG’s channel gains over 6,000 new subscribers and around 6,500,000 views.

NG is quite clearly proud of his community. His social media is full of posts praising his fans for their dedication and continued support. And the liking appears to be mutual. It’s no secret that the comment sections of most YouTubers are filled with a lot of negativity. This isn’t the case with NG Slot. If you were to scroll down under one of NG’s videos, you would find nothing but support and encouragement.

NG Slot’s most popular video was uploaded in May 2019. It’s called “Biggest Handpay Jackpot On YOUTUBE HISTORY” and has managed to amass close to 1,500,000 views.

A Recipe For YouTube Success

As we mentioned before, the success of the NG Slot YouTube channel can be attributed to several key factors. The most important one is undoubtedly NG’s undeniable charisma, energy, and love of casino slots. He loves what he’s doing and his excitement is downright infectious. NG’s informal, down-to-earth vlogging style makes his videos a pleasure to watch. It almost feels like you’re going to a casino with a friend. And his good production quality, eye-catching thumbnails, and click-inducing video titles don’t hurt either.

But that’s just part of the story.

NG Slot is a true workaholic. He uploads one or two videos every single day, and he’s been doing that for years. And since his content is centered around casino slots, doing so isn’t cheap either. In January 2020, NG Slot played through over $50,000 USD worth of spins.

NG Slot Net Worth & Personal Life

NG Slot prefers to keep his private life private and does not disclose his real name. What we do know is that he resides in Los Angeles, California, and makes frequent trips to neighboring states in search of new slots to play for his YouTube Channel.

NG does not disclose his net worth and yearly income, but we can make an informed guess. Unlike many gambling-related YouTube channels, NG Slot manages to keep his monetization running most of the time. And his advertising doesn’t seem to be stunted in any way, either. We tested this out by watching 5 NG Slots videos one after another. The result? We got ads on 3 of them.

Social Blade rates NG Slot’s as a B+ grade channel and estimates his advertising earnings to be somewhere in the range between $2,000 to $25,000. Knowing that most of his audience is located in the US (a market with high-paying ads), his YouTube earnings could equal $10,000-$15,000 USD on a good month.

As of October 2020, Social Blade estimates NG Slot’s earnings to be from $2k to $30k a month.

As is the case with most gambling YouTubers, most of his income probably comes from affiliate deals with online casinos, as well as donations he receives on his live streams.

NG Slot also runs a Patreon, although he isn’t overly active on the platform. His lowest patron tier starts at $2 a month and the most expensive one clocks in at a cool $1,500 per month.

Another source of income for NG is his online store on Teespring. In it, NG Slots sells T-shirts, sweatshirts, hoodies, sports bags, and phone cases.
